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Design, configure, test, and implement networking software, computer hardware, and operating system software solutions.
  • Maintain and administer computer networks and related computing environments, including systems software, applications software, hardware, and configurations.
  • Protect data, software, and hardware by coordinating, planning, and implementing network security measures.
  • Troubleshoot, diagnose, and resolve hardware, software, and other network and system problems.
  • Replace faulty network hardware components when necessary.
  • Maintain, configure, and monitor virus protection software and email applications.
  • Monitor network performance to determine if adjustments need to be made.
  • Operate master consoles to monitor the performance of networks and computer systems.
  • Coordinate computer network access and use.
  • Create relevant documentation as required including but not limited to conceptual design, logical design, physical design, as-built diagrams, knowledge transfer materials, and transition to operations information.
  • Recommend changes to improve systems and network configurations in client environments and determine hardware or software requirements.

Experience You Bring:

  • 7+ years of experience with network architecture design and deployment
  • Capability to perform network assessments and provide design recommendations
  • Ability to create accurate network diagrams and documentation for design and planning network communication systems.
  • Ability to implement, administer, and troubleshoot network infrastructure devices, including wireless access points, firewall, routers, switches, controllers. Experience with some or all of the following:
  • ○ Firewalls, IPS/IDS, VMware SD-WAN, TCP/IP, IPSEC Site to Site VPN, GRE, DMVPN, NAT, VRF technologies, Wireless design
  • ○ Data Center technologies such as VPC, VDC, FcoE, FC, virtual switching
  • ○ Fortinet, Cisco IOS ,NXOS, Meraki, Palo Alto, Software-defined networking(SDN), Network monitoring solutions
  • ○ Layer 2 technologies such as switching, VLAN, spanning tree
  • ○ Layer 3 routing protocols including MPLS, BCP, EIGRP, OSPF
